Overview
ACRs are sometimes installed in network configurations where power
flow could be in either direction through the switchgear. Directional
Protection can be used when the ACR is required to coordinate with
different protection devices depending on which side of the switchgear
the fault is detected that is whether the power flow during a fault
is forward or reverse. When power flows from Source to Load, the power
flow is deemed to be forward. Reverse power flows from Load to Source.
The Source and Load sides of the switchgear are configurable through

The Power Direction setting can be found on the WSOS Measurements page or on the operator interface.
Directional Protection is an optional protection feature that uses separate protection groups to determine pickup thresholds and protection timing depending on which side of the switchgear the fault has been detected.
When Directional Protection is On, there are always two protection groups active. One group is for forward faults and the other is for reverse faults. If the controller is configured for ten protection groups, five pairs will be available as shown in the table below.

Which pair becomes active when Directional Protection is turned On depends on which group was previously active. If Group A was active, Groups A and B will become active. If Group D was active, Groups C and D will become active.
The active protection groups can be changed to another pair once Directional Protection is On.

Directional Protection can only be turned on from the WSOS Feature Selection page. It can’t be turned on from the Options pages on the setVUE O.I. or the Feature Selection pages on the flexVUE O.I.
